Stanley April 27, 2019 "Repent and live" Ezekiel 18:32 Have you considered what happens when we sin? We attempt to meet our needs apart from the Lord. Because of this, we become self-centered and drift away from God and His plan. We move further away from Him until, eventually, we may reject the idea that we need His presence at all. The natural result of this is that we face pain, loneliness, and frustration. Why? Because we don't have the inner resources to bring peace to our troubled hearts, having shut out the only One who can provide them to us-God Himself. He created us to soar like eagles, but instead we become earthbound creatures who have lost the capacity to be who He made us to be. We've clipped our own wings by denying His leadership-which means we won't find the purpose and meaning He created us to enjoy. However, this empty restlessness is actually a good thing because it opens the door for our loving Father to make contact with us again. If you're feeling the inner warning signals of suffering, purposelessness, uselessness, or frustration, examine your heart. You may be attempting to satisfy your needs apart from God. Thankfully, He wants you back. Don't deny Him. Repent and live. Jesus, please reveal my sin so I can repent of it and experience Your peace. Stanley April 28, 2019 "Blessed are those who have not seen and yet have believed" John 20:29 Are you overwhelmed by fears and doubts today? You many think yourself full of faith, but if your frightened by what could happen or what the future may hold-then your trust in God may not be as strong as you believe it to be. It's important that you realize that genuine faith means knowing that the Father will provide His best for you as you walk with Him. Although what He perceives as most beneficial for you may be different from what you envision, you can be confident that He understands what you really need. The One who created you ultimately knows what will truly satisfy your soul-even better than you do. So what is it that's making you anxious today? Is there something you fear you'll never achieve? Does it seem as though He's taking a long time answering some important request? Trust God. You may not see what He is doing, but that's the essence of faith-not seeing, but still believing. The Lord will provide what you need. And if God does not give you what your heart presently longs for, it's certainly because He has something far better planned for you. Jesus, I trust You will provide Your best for me. Thank you for leading me. Amen 1 1 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

John 6:63 You will never outgrow the need to depend upon the Holy Spirit. In fact, the more mature you grow in your faith, the more you will need to rely on His indwelling presence. I say this to you because He is who you need for all you face. If you have been depending on your own resources, wisdom, or strength, it's no wonder you become tired, overwhelmed, and frustrated, possibly even feeling somewhat hopeless. What is before you is often greater than you can handle so you will learn to rely on Him. It is the Holy Spirit who guides you on the right path, convicts you of sin, reminds you of God's truth, and teaches you to apply Scripture to your life. But even more importantly, it is the Holy Spirit who works to conform you to the image of Christ and who empowers you to serve Him and others. This is why the lesson all believers must learn is how to experience and live daily in the power of the Holy Spirit. No matter where you are in your journey with Jesus, this is the key to being a truly successful, fulfilled, productive, and joyful Christian. Jesus, thank You for Your Holy Spirit, who guides and empowers me to depend on You more every day. Amen 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Perhaps your immediate answer is no. But if you're having trouble doing what He asks of you, then you are. Of course, what He commands is never easy because it means giving up ungodly thought patterns and behaviors or confronting wounds and beliefs that you've held since childhood. You may also need to relinquish your desires or the possessions you depend upon for security and worth. So it may appear far more agreeable to live in the same defeated status quo than to experience the extraordinary life God has planned for you. Certainly, its a discipline and sacrifice to let go-it's not easy for anyone. Our fleshly nature holds on and opposes the liberating work of the Holy Spirit at every turn. Even so, when you allow Him to change you, you will experience joyous liberty and assurance. Be confident that if the Father asks you to surrender something it is because He has something better for you. He is faithful to do what's in your best interest and lead you to freedom He created you to enjoy.-no Jesus, help me to do as You ask-no matter how difficult. I trust You to lead me to freedom.
